The first recording

Add the first recording

  1. Move the play head to approximately 0:35.

  2. On the left-hand side of the timeline, select Recording.

  3. Select your recording for the clown fish.

  4. Select Load.

  5. In the Load Recording prompt, select Load.

  6. Place your recording in the same location where you previously placed the 3D Buttons.

  7. If required, rotate the avatar to face the user.

Add a jump to the recording

1. On the timeline, select the cog for the Clown button container.

2. On the Current Effect Options page, in the Triggered Effects section, select NEW.

3. From the available effects, select IFX.

4. From the IFX library select Skip to Time (Lesson Seek).

5. Place the effect in the environment. Its location is not important.

6. On the timeline, select the cog for the Clown button container.

7. On the Current Effect Options, select the cog for the Skip to Time triggered effect.

8. In the TIME VALUE field, type 00:00:35. This is the start time for the clown fish recording.

9. Select SAVE EFFECT.

Minimize the editor panel and test your sequence. If you select the Clown Fish button, you should jump to the recording.
